I’ve had this happen more than a couple times- I will research a product + its ingredient list from YesStyle and then buy it from Stylevana for the affordable price, only to find out that Stylevana somehow was selling a new/old version of said product with quite a few differences in what was originally thought to be the ingredient list.

As someone with extremely fussy skin, this is very frustrating 🙁 these Isntree Onion toner pads do not mention Polysorbate 60 on Yesstyle, but the product which arrived from Stylevana does 🙁 kinda irks me that Stylevana doesn’t update ingredient lists on their website so you can know what version you’re getting.

I am confused—OY lists polysorbate 60 but only on their Korean site? Have these toner pads been reformulated? Was so looking forward to them…

  1. It’s how the regulations states the ingredients are to be presented. Onion bulb extract isn’t just the extract: it is made up of water, preservative and other ingredients as well. In this case, polysorbate.

    Picture 2 is the more accurate breakdown of ingredients.

    Some countries allow the extract listing but some countries’ regulations are more strict and require the full breakdown of what’s in the extract, which means water is almost always the first ingredient. Hence picture 2.
